EIT Raw Materials Business Plan 2023-2025

Last updated: 21.7.2025
Grant

The EIT Raw Materials Business Plan 2023-2025 is a closed call under Horizon Europe, specifically inviting proposals for the EIT Raw Materials Knowledge and Innovation Community (KIC). Its primary objective is to drive the implementation of the KIC's multi-annual strategy, fostering excellence and significant impact in the raw materials sector. This initiative aims to address societal challenges and integrate knowledge, education, and innovation, aligning with the broader EIT Impact Framework.
